PMDAPMID(3) Library Functions Manual PMDAPMID(3)
NAME
pmdaPMID - translate a dynamic performance metric name into a PMID
C SYNOPSIS
#include <pcp/pmapi.h>
#include <pcp/impl.h>
#include <pcp/pmda.h>
int pmdaPMID(char *name, pmID *pmid, pmdaExt *pmda);
cc ... -lpcp_pmda -lpcp
DESCRIPTION
As part of the Performance Metrics Domain Agent (PMDA) API (see PMDA(3)), pmdaPMID is the generic callback for translating a dynamic metric
name into a PMID (pmid).
Because implementing dynamic performance metrics requires specific PMDA support, and the facility is an optional component of a PMDA (most
PMDAs do not support dynamic performance metrics), pmdaPMID is a skeleton implementation that returns PM_ERR_NAME.
A PMDA that supports dynamic performance metrics will provide a private callback that replaces pmdaPMID (by assignment to version.four.pmid
of the pmdaInterface structure) and implements the translation from a dynamic performance metric name into the associated pmid.
DIAGNOSTICS
pmdaPMID returns PM_ERR_NAME if the name is not recognized or cannot be translated, else returns 0.
CAVEAT
The PMDA must be using PMDA_PROTOCOL_4 or later, as specified in the call to pmdaDSO(3) or pmdaDaemon(3).
